The LS223 coating Thickness Gauge can be used not only for coating ferromagnetic metal substrates such as steelMeasurement of non-magnetic coatings such as materials, varnishes, enamels, chromium, galvanization, etc., can also be used for copper, aluminum, and pressingNon-conductive coatings, anodized layers, ceramics and other non-magnetic metal substrates such as cast zinc and brassMeasurement of electric coatings. The instrument automatically recognizes the type of measurement substrate and automatically switches the measurement mode.
It is widely used in manufacturing, metal processing industry, chemical industry, commodity inspection and other fields.

1. No need to calibrate, just zero adjustment.
2. Separate buttons, the operation is very simple.
3. The measurement is fast, and a measurement can be completed in 0.5 seconds.
4. Ultra-large range test, the thickest can be measured up to 5mm.
5. The wear resistance of the ruby probe ensures the long-term and effective use of the instrument.
6. Iron and aluminum dual-purpose probe, automatic identification of the measurement substrate, can be quickly and automatically converted.
7. "Fe", "NFe", "Fe/NFe" three measurement modes can be set.
8. It can measure the thickness of the non-magnetic overlay on magnetic metal substrates such as steel, and the thickness of non-conductive overlays on non-magnetic metal substrates such as copper and aluminum.
9. Using professional digital probe technology, digital signal processing is completed directly on the probe, the probe is not easy to be disturbed and provides excellent test accuracy. Even temperature changes do not affect the measurement, and the readings remain stable to ensure very good repeatability throughout the measurement.
